如何建立自己的APN服务器? apn怎么搭建服务器

APN(Apple Push Notification)是苹果公司的推送服务,可以将消息推送到苹果设备上,为移动应用提供了一种快捷有效的通知方式 。本文将介绍如何搭建APN服务器的步骤和方法 。
一、安装SSL证书
在搭建APN服务器之前,首先需要安装一个SSL证书,这里我们以阿里云SSL证书为例 。安装好证书后 , 生成一个.pem格式的证书文件,并将该文件保存到服务器上 。
二、安装APNS库
APNS库是苹果为开发者提供的一个开发工具包,可以通过它来进行消息发送和接收 。我们可以通过cocoapods来安装APNS库 。
三、配置APN证书
将之前生成的.pem格式的证书文件上传到服务器上,然后将其转换成.p12格式 , 接着在代码中使用APNS库加载该证书即可 。
四、实现消息推送
使用APNS库 , 可以将消息推送到指定的设备上 。在构建消息时,可以设置消息的标题、内容等属性,并指定要发送的设备信息 。
五、测试服务器
在搭建完APN服务器后,需要对其进行测试 。可以使用APNS库提供的测试工具来测试 。测试时,需要在代码中指定开发环境或生产环境 , 并将测试证书添加到代码中 。
【如何建立自己的APN服务器? apn怎么搭建服务器】本文介绍了如何搭建APN服务器的步骤和方法 。需要注意的是 , 在搭建APN服务器前,需要先安装SSL证书,并且在代码中使用APNS库加载证书 。之后,我们可以通过APNS库将消息推送到指定的设备上,最后还要对服务器进行测试,确保其正常工作 。

    推荐阅读